Editor of the advice website gadget detective dot com and joins us this afternoon Hello Kai what a mess this was for 02 yesterday I mean catastrophe might not be too strong a word for them yeah so they the service was down pretty much for a whole day should have taken that long to get it back up again and it's not unique I mean you ask you know how much reputational damage will they suffer probably in the long term not that much he had an even longer outage a couple of years ago I think that's sort of long forgiven as long as they don't make a habit of it but I think it does tell us that these companies need to do more to protect what are essentially quite vulnerable services I mean the vulnerable to all sorts of attacks we see how computer systems get hacked all the time so it's possible to that he's vulnerable to human errors as may have been the case here vulnerable to espionage in our data being stolen so the data is now utility we expect to have it when we want it in the same way as city when we flip a light switch we expect the light to come on and for there to be juice coming out of the sockets so they have to do more now to increase the reliability of that data and just give me an idea of the scale of how intertwined data is with our life because I had a message from from an older listener who said I don't understand what the problem is people's mobiles are still working the mobile network was still working but the data network wasn't working why is that such a big problem but for many people I mean that is the only source of communication that they use they don't use the old mobile network anymore Sure well 1st of all at 3 o'clock yesterday is a no to use the I lost text and voice calls as well some some users did lose everything the other thing is that certain voice communication such as Face Time and Skype and the rest of those apps that we use to communicate by voice use data not more conventional when it's on a mobile phone contract but also.
